Engineering News-Record announced that the seismic assessment project of the Rondanini Pietà, Michelangelo's latest masterpiece, has won the "Global Best Project 2016". A highly prestigious award won for the third year by the engineering office Miyamoto International, who coordinated the whole project. The award is also a recognition of the work done by Kimia, which developed the anchoring system of the sculpture to the anti-seismic basement.

The famous Michelangelo's sculpture, dating back to the XVI century, from May 2nd 2015, at the opening of EXPO 2015, is back again visible to visitors from around the world inside a new location of the Palazzo Sforzesco in Milan. Infact, after 60 years spent in the Hall of the Scarlioni, it has been housed in one of the lovely rooms recently recovered from the ancient Spanish Hospital and placed, for the occasion, on an advanced basement able to make it immune from both eventual seismic actions and frequent vibrations generated by the visitors and by the passage of the underground trains nearby.

Kimitech FRP-LOCK® – Patented antidelamination locking system

Kimitech FRP-LOCK®Kimitech FRP-LOCK® is the mechanical locking system patented, tested and certified to be used together with a structural reinforcement with composite materials, in order to improve the performances of the system in its entirety.

Kimitech FRP-LOCK® action, indeed, by preventing the delamination of the fibers applied to the support, let the locking system be more efficient by best exploiting the resistances theoretically ensured by the composites.
